JJ Grey and Mofro Announce New Album and Spring Tour
Posted by jaybird | Filed under Uncategorized

Jacksonville-based singer/songwriter JJ Grey will release THIS RIVER on Tuesday, April 16, 2013. This is Grey’s seventh album (his fifth for Alligator Records) and his first studio album since 2010′s acclaimed Georgia Warhorse. The New York Times says Grey’s singing is “impassioned” and the band plays “riff-based Southern rock, cold-blooded swamp funk and sly Memphis soul.”

Rock Candy Funk Party is a celebatory band spinning a fresh take on 70′s and 80′s funk and jazz. The group is powered by a lineup of world renowned players: album producer Tal Bergman (drums), Joe Bonamassa (guitar), Ron DeJesus (guitar), Mike Merritt (bass) and Renato Neto (keys) who got together for this project in the sheer joy of making music and a mutual love on genre-blurring grooves.
